1) Switch up your textiles - I think it's important to keep your main furniture somewhat neutral so you are able to switch up the feel of your space with decor and textiles. The throw on my bed from Anthropologie has a darker blue stripe on one side, so to make it feel brighter I now fold it with the lighter stripe showing. I also recently purchased lighter gray pillow covers from Motif Pillows on Etsy that I am loving and work perfect with my more colorful handmade kilim pillow from Blue Salvage




2) Flip your mattress - It's not all about the way your room looks. Just like you may flip your sofa cushions for even wear, you can do the same with your mattress (if not a pillow top) to improve comfort and longevity. We've been thinking about getting a new mattress and have had our eye's on the Leesa Mattress - we've heard great things about the comfort of the memory foam which is what our current mattress is lacking. The perfect time to do this is the start of a new season!




3) Add fresh greenery - I love shopping for new succulents and plants at the farmers market in NYC, usually in Union Square. I recently just purchased this planter from West Elm for our living room and trying to figure out what type of larger plant would work best. For our bedroom, an assortment of smaller succulents is the perfect touch to make it feel more like spring. I like to place them on different areas on my desk shelving like below.  More to come!

My swatches from MotifPillows on Etsy came the other day and I finally placed my order! I ordered two of these handmade shibori inspired pillows for our bedroom and another swatch to be delivered. You may be thinking, "What the heck is shibori and who puts that much thought into just pillows??" Well to answer part one, shibori is a type of Japanese handmade dying technique dating back to the 8th century so each pillow made with this technique is a meticulous one-of-a-kind piece. To answer part two, me! and I am not the only one. Pillows are just one simple way to make a huge impact and quick change to a space which is why I love pillows and all textiles so much. I don't mind spending a little more for a handmade pillow and supporting small businesses!
